Paul Merchants Ltd has published the notice for its 41st Annual General Meeting (AGM) along with e-voting details in two newspapers — The Financial Express (English) and Jansatta (Hindi). This is a routine regulatory requirement under SEBI and Companies Act rules, where listed companies must inform shareholders about the AGM schedule, agenda, and remote e-voting facility through newspaper advertisements. The publication confirms that shareholders will be able to vote electronically on resolutions placed before the AGM. No financial results, dividends, or major corporate actions are mentioned in this filing.
This is a routine compliance disclosure with no material impact on the stock price or shareholder value. It simply ensures shareholders are aware of the upcoming AGM and their voting rights, and shareholders should look out for the actual AGM date, time, and resolutions.
